Leadership is not a term that should be used lightly, because not everyone can be a leader. A person is sometimes born a leader and others are modeled into being a leader by the effects of what has happened in their lives. The majority of people are followers; to be a leader it takes a special type of person to meet the qualifications to be held in the regard to be a leader. A leader is someone who can inspire people to do great evil or to conquer all odds. They hold a substantial amount of power and influence over others. They have influence over other and are able to inspire when the situation is desperate. A leader must be able to make tough decision and see that they are carried out, because they have to be able to choose between a single person and the greater good.
Leaders typically have unique personality characteristics. They are self directed, hardworking, persistent, informed, knowledgeable, and have skills such as public speaking, problem solving, delegation and the ability to understand and manipulate people. Leaders are also known to be able to create a bias and project it to the public to sway opinions.
A leader should strive to up hold a very high moral character. A leader’s reputation is one of the keys to their success. Followers must be able to rely and believe in what a leader says. When the followers begin to doubt what the leader states then he is no longer a leader because a leader is just a person that people follow and with no followers there ceases to be a leader.
